Just loaded up both Revs to head to Revy.
07 XRS Summit was running fine, but from garage to trailer have no lights, no tach/gauges. no tail light.

Checked fuses, there okay...

Sled runs fine.

Any hints that might help me. I will still ride, but it will shorten the days with no lights.

Have not checked for power on one side of the fuses as we are leaving at 04:00,

Any one with the same problem that might help would be appreciated.

it's the relay

just had this problem on my 03 last week,you can get a new one at any automotive parts store i got mine for under 4 bucks. grab two while your there as this seems to be a real common deal with ski doo.

There is a thread or two on here but i can't find them tonight

If you still need i will get you part #s tomorrow don't buy from dealer as I heard they will charge over $30 for the same part

NAPA number AR201 for a 04 rev 800 probaly the same for yours. Just take yours in with you to confirm you get the right one. Yes it is the relay on the l/s, probaly zip tied to the brace. Mine was zip tied to the throttle cable.
